Output e898d3eef879ddeaed51c847b6813408a8564bae4dd8aeda946bcd0f08abe297:1

value
19288364
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fd2491aa2e7216d724860a157e8da24b03375b42 OP_EQUALVERIFY OP_CHECKSIG
address
1Q5VmPjazqQGtAHpBfi14LpqhgRt1x6KFJ
transaction
e898d3eef879ddeaed51c847b6813408a8564bae4dd8aeda946bcd0f08abe297
confirmations
439625
spent
true